Pandalam Palace
Overview
Pandalam Palace, located in the state of Kerala, India, is a historic and cultural landmark. This magnificent palace showcases traditional Kerala architecture and design, with intricate wood carvings, ornate furnishings, and sprawling courtyards. It is also famous for its association with the royal family of Pandalam, who played a significant role in the history and culture of the region. Visitors can explore the rich heritage of the palace through guided tours, showcasing the opulent lifestyle of the royal family and the historical significance of the site. Pandalam Palace stands as a testament to the grandeur and elegance of Kerala's royal past.
